猿代码-超算人才智造局 | 《协议班》签约入职国家超算中心/研究院 点击进入 CUDA面试大计划:制定你的CUDA面试计划! 大家好,欢迎来到本文!今天我们将为您详细介绍如何制定一个成功的CUDA面试计划。如果您是一个渴望进入并在CUDA编程领域发展的程序员,那么本文对您来说将是非常有用的。 首先,让我们来了解一下什么是CUDA。CUDA是英伟达推出的一种并行计算平台和应用程序编程接口,它能够利用GPU的强大计算能力来加速各种计算任务。因此,掌握CUDA编程技术已经成为许多公司招聘人才的重要条件。 那么,如何制定一个高效的CUDA面试计划呢?首先,我们需要准备一份全面而系统的学习指南。这份学习指南应该包括以下几个方面: 1. 基础知识:CUDA编程的基础知识是您成功面试的关键。您需要了解CUDA的架构、内存模型以及GPU编程的基本原理。可以通过阅读相关的书籍和教程来深入学习。 2. 理论实践:除了理论知识外,您还需要进行实际的编程练习。可以通过完成一些小项目或者参与开源项目来提高您的实践能力。 3. 算法和优化:在面试中,算法和优化也是非常重要的考察点。您需要掌握各种并行计算算法,并且能够对代码进行有效的优化。 4. 项目经验:如果您有相关的项目经验,一定要在面试中充分展示出来。这可以证明您在实际应用中的能力和经验。 除了准备学习指南,我们还需要一份完整的面试准备清单。这个清单包括以下几个方面: 1. 了解公司:在面试前,您需要对申请的公司进行全面的了解。包括公司的业务领域、项目类型以及可能涉及到的CUDA技术栈等。 2. 面试题库:收集和整理常见的CUDA面试题目,并进行分类和归纳。这样可以帮助您更好地理解面试的考察点。 3. 刷题计划:制定一个刷题计划,每天花一定的时间进行刷题。这样可以帮助您熟悉各种问题类型,并提高您的解题能力。 4. 模拟面试:找一些同行或者朋友进行模拟面试,从而提高您的面试技巧和应变能力。 最后,我们还需要进行一些实践操作来加深对CUDA的理解。您可以尝试自己编写一些小型的CUDA程序,并进行调试和优化。这样可以帮助您更好地理解CUDA的工作原理和应用场景,并在面试中更好地回答问题。 总之,制定一个成功的CUDA面试计划并不是一件简单的事情。但是只要您按照上述步骤进行规划和准备,相信您一定能够在面试中脱颖而出。祝您早日取得CUDA编程的成功,并在这个领域中大展拳脚! 感谢您阅读本文,希望对您有所帮助。如果您对CUDA面试或者其他相关问题有任何疑问,欢迎在下方留言,我将会为您解答。祝您在CUDA面试中取得好运!
《协议班》签约入职国家超算中心/研究院 点击进入
|
说点什么...